>> Apologies about Linuxism question: we do not have "nodev" mount option 
>> (I just double checked with man mount). Are we weaker here than Linux 
>> folks? I do use "nodev" in addition to the above on world writable mount 
>> points on Linux boxes.
> 
> The mknod man page says that devices outside of devfs don't work since
> FreeBSD 6.0. So there's no need for "nodev".
